Preview
Iceland began their Nations League campaign with a 2-2 draw against Israel on Friday.
Abada and Weissman scored for the hosts before Iceland’s Helgason and Sigurdsson’s strikes ensured a point a piece.
Iceland is yet to win a single match across competitions since their 4-0 win over Liechtenstein in October 2021.
On the other hand, this is Albania’s opening match of the campaign and they would look to kick start with just the victory needed.

With just 1 win from their last 5 matches across competitions, the visitors lack confident and desire to gain momentum.
However, this is a chance to make a difference and a win could spark a revival of sorts.
Both sides last met in a Euro qualification match in 2019 where Albania won 4-2 at home.
